Hononegah is 9-1 against Belvidere since April of 2019 and they'll have a chance to extend that dominance on Friday. The Indians will head out to face off against the Bucs at 4:00 p.m. Hononegah will be looking to extend their current four-game winning streak.
Hononegah had to skate by with only a one-run margin when they last took the field, which might have inspired the 11-run drubbing they dealt Jefferson on Thursday. The Indians put the hurt on the J-Hawks with a sharp 14-3 victory. Considering the Indians have won 12 matches by more than five runs this season, Thursday's blowout was nothing new.
Samantha Nosbisch looked comfortable as she pitched two innings while giving up no earned runs or hits. She has been consistent: she hasn't given up more than one walk in five consecutive appearances.

On the hitting side, Kaelyn Kelly was a standout: she went 4-for-5 with four stolen bases, three runs, and two RBI. Those four stolen bases gave her a new career-high. Alexis Eich was another key player, going a perfect 3-for-3 with five RBI, three doubles, and one run.
Hononegah kept the outfield on their toes and finished the game with 18 hits. That strong performance was nothing new for the team: they've now got at least ten hits in four consecutive games.
Meanwhile, there's no place like home for Belvidere, who bounced back after a loss on the road on Monday. They came out on top in a nail-biter against Freeport on Thursday, sneaking past 6-5.
Hononegah's record now sits at 23-4. As for Belvidere, their record is now 15-10.
Everything went Hononegah's way against Belvidere in their previous meeting back in April of 2024, as Hononegah made off with a 16-6 win. The rematch might be a little tougher for the Indians since the squad won't have the home-field advantage this time around. We'll see if the change in venue makes a difference.
